Routine Dental Care

Even if you don't notice any signs of infection on your teeth or oral health issues, it is crucial to seek routine dental care on a regular basis. Without a routine dental checkup at least once every six months, there is a higher chance of oral health issues gradually getting worse. Fortunately, we can help provide the treatment and routine dental care you need for healthy teeth.

During an appointment, we will provide a professional cleaning of your teeth. A professional cleaning reaches areas of the teeth that a toothbrush cannot reach. We will check the health of each tooth, the gums, and the tongue.

If we notice signs of any oral health conditions or infections, then we will administer treatment. In many cases, an infection starts with minor symptoms and is easier to treat in the early stages. With preventive care, we can take a proactive approach to oral health and prevent an infection before it advances.

Along with cleaning the teeth, we will also help go over tips for proper oral hygiene at home. For instance, did you know there are different types of toothbrush bristles? In some cases, if you use the wrong toothbrush, you may damage your teeth.

We can help to recommend the most effective toothbrush for your needs, along with going over the proper brushing technique.
